What is Non-fiction Book Report

The Summer Reading Non-fiction Book Report is a report card template used by students to document their reading of a non-fiction book during summer break.

How to fill out the Non-fiction Book Report

  1. 1.
    Start by accessing the Summer Reading Non-fiction Book Report on pdfFiller's website or app. Use the search bar to find the form quickly if needed.
  2. 2.
    Once the form is open, review all sections carefully, noting the fields that require your input. Familiarize yourself with the layout to make filling it out streamlined.
  3. 3.
    Gather all necessary information about the non-fiction book you've chosen. This includes the title, author, the date you finished reading, and any notable facts or insights you want to include.
  4. 4.
    Begin filling in the form by entering your name in the designated field. Proceed to input the book title and author accurately.
  5. 5.
    As you reach the section prompting for the date finished, ensure that you format the date correctly as requested in the form.
  6. 6.
    Utilize the fillable fields to articulate why you chose that particular book, the author's purpose, and any interesting chapters or events that stood out during your reading.
  7. 7.
    Make sure to capture new facts or ideas you learned and provide your personal feedback or recommendations in the appropriate sections. Take your time to reflect and ensure clarity.
  8. 8.
    Review all of your entries for accuracy and completeness before finishing up. Verify that no fields are left blank unless specified.
  9. 9.
    Once satisfied with your submission, navigate to the save options presented on pdfFiller. Decide whether to download a copy for yourself, save it to your account, or submit it directly if required.
